A Deep Dive Into “permissive

Meaning

  • [Adjective]
  • Giving permission, or predisposed to give it; lenient.
  • (of a footpath, bridleway or similar) Open to the public by permission of the landowner.
  • (biology) That allows the replication of viruses.
  • [Noun]
  • (grammar) A grammatical form indicating that an action is permitted by the speaker.
